Madagascar Nicknames and Country Symbols
Overview of Madagascar According to physicscat.com, Madagascar is an island nation located off the east coast of Africa in the Indian Ocean. It is the fourth-largest island in the world, and is home to...
Overview of Madagascar According to physicscat.com, Madagascar is an island nation located off the east coast of Africa in the Indian Ocean. It is the fourth-largest island in the world, and is home to...